The purple wedding is the fangiven nickname for the wedding between king joffrey i baratheon and margaery tyrell on the first day of the new century, 300 ac. The execution of eddard stark is a pivotal event in the nascent conflict caused by the death of robert baratheon, paving the way for its transformation into a fullfledged civil war.
